u/typesoshee Jan 23 '16
I believe they aren't on better terms (the bad blood is only between Matsumoto and Ota Hikari of Bakusho Mondai). Another reason why this "stage crashing" was news in Japanese entertainment was because it ended up with Matsumoto and Ota on the same stage. You'll notice that Hamada and Tanaka Yuji of Bakuksho Mondai interact a lot on stage (no doubt to cover up any awkwardness on the air between Matsumoto and Ota), but Matsumoto and Ota don't.

u/typesoshee Jan 23 '16 edited Jan 23 '16
Not a skit, it's a live day-time variety show (their final episode). Other than Tamori, they were supposed to appear separately one after another (something like Sanma and each duo gets 10 minutes of talk time with Tamori), but Sanma went over his allotted time so Downtown decided to "crash" the stage, and then the others also followed and crashed, and then it just became one huge live talk segment on stage.
